It’s official: Recall elections set for May 8, June 5
Wisconsin NewsThe Wisconsin elections panel voted today to hold separate recall elections against Gov. Scott Walker and Lt. Gov. Rebecca Kleefisch. The Government Accountability Board unanimously certified just over 900,000 petition signatures for the Walker recall effort and about 809,000 signatures for the effort to unseat Kleefisch. Both numbers were well above the 540,000 needed to force the recall votes.

Wisconsin wires $60 million to Minnesota; Hopes high to reinstate income tax reciprocity soon
He didn’t come check in hand. The money had been wired Tuesday evening. But Gov. Scott Walker held a press conference Wednesday morning to announce that Wisconsin has paid off its $60 million tax reciprocity debt to Minnesota.

Kloppenburg concedes state Supreme Court election
JoAnne Kloppenburg said late this morning she will not challenge the results of this month’s statewide recount of the Supreme Court election in which she lost to incumbent Justice David Prosser by just over 7,000 votes.

Kohl won't run for re-election
Wisconsin’s senior U.S. senator will not run for re-election next year. Democrat Herb Kohl made the announcement at 11 a.m. today in his hometown of Milwaukee. Kohl, 76, will step down after his current term ends in January 2013.
